I just received my eagerly awaited copy a few days ago. I would say read the manual, its well written and not difficult to plough through. The forum search function has been very useful for picking up anything not covered in the manual, as somebody has probably already asked the questions you may have.
The game has not been difficult to get into, but the nuances and optimal settings for things are more complex. In short a wonderfully absorbing game, you will suffer from "just one more turn syndrome at 3 in the morning:)

I was in your shoes just one week ago. Then the UPS man delivered me from boredom. I've never had so much fun watching my ships slip below the surface. I have spent the last week playing UV and trying to learn just one piece at a time. Experimenting with the different mission types and settings for TF's while not worrying what happens to the ground pounders at PM. Next I will focus on a large scale ground operation while ignoring most of what happens at sea. After I see how these pieces work, I will start juggling them all through some of the bigger scenerios.
The manual is a good one, and reading it repeatedly while playing will teach you many new things every time.
These forums are a treasure trove of useful information. Check out the War Room sub-forum for many good ideas, and the After Action Reports sub-forum for ideas on strategy.
I plan for my "shakedown cruise" to take another 2 - 3 weeks. After that, I will consider myself an UV player. It may take a long while before I think of myself as a good player, but that's where the challenge is!
